The Wild beating the super stacked Avalanche team in 2003 to advance to the Conference Finals comes to mind for a part two. Remember, that was back when expansion teams completely sucked, and the Wild had to split players with Columbus just three years prior, all while the Thrashers and Predators also had their picks the previous two seasons. And it happened in Game 7, OT. Andrew Brunette became the very last player to score on Patrick Roy that night.
